Selected Publications
- Shuck, B., & Reio, T., & Rocco, T. (2011). Employee engagement: An antecedent and outcome approach to model development. Human Resource Development International, 14(4), 427-445.
- Weinstein, M., & Shuck, B. (2011). Social ecology and individual training and development in organizations: Introducing the social in instructional system design. Human Resource Development Review, 10(3), 286-303. doi: 10.1177/1534484311411074
- Shuck, B. (2011). Four emerging perspectives of employee engagement: An integrative literature review. Human Resource Development Review, 10(3), 304-328. doi: 10.1177/1534484311410840
- Shuck, B., Rocco, T., & Albornoz, C. (2011). Exploring employee engagement from the employee perspective: Implications for HRD. Journal of European Industrial Training 35(4), 300-325. doi: 10.1108/03090591111128306
- Shuck, B., & Wollard, K. (2010). Employee engagement & HRD: A seminal review of the foundations. Human Resource Development Review, 9(1), 89-110. doi: 10.1177/1534484309353560
- Shuck, B., and Wollard, K. (2008). Employee engagement: Motivating and connecting with tomorrow's workforce. New Horizons in Adult Education and Human Resource Development, 22(1), 48-53.
